When you get ready to put it together, lay it all out and number each one with a small scrap of paper and pin it on. (I have to pin mine on or else the cat moves the little pieces of paper around :oops: :oops: :oops: ) And the way you pin the number on, would indicate orientation of the block. sewjoyce--what I've done with the others--and ragged flannels--anything that has a pattern really--is lay it out, take a photo of it, pick the rows up in order--label the rows with sticky notes, stack them...print the photo and tape it to the file by my sewing machine... then study each two squares to attempt getting it right... and STILL I goof it up. I'll check it row by row so I can fix mistakes without too much trouble. :wink:
